Bamboo socks are reason for warnings

Tightly woven textiles cannot be made from the natural fibre bamboo because the raw materials are subjected to a viscose process in which the properties of the raw material are lost. Therefore, it must not be advertised that it is bamboo.

trade-e-bility already reported on pollutants in plastic tableware made from bamboo. Now, online retailers of textiles also need to be attentive when it comes to bamboo products.

As Online Retailer News reports, the labelling of materials can quickly become grounds for admonition letters. A dealer who offered “bamboo socks” on his site received an admonition letter instigated by a competitor. The reason: Tightly woven textiles cannot be made from the natural fibre bamboo because the raw materials are subjected to a viscose process in which the properties of the raw material are lost. Therefore, it must not be advertised that it is bamboo.
